CISkillsetWs

package
v0.0.0-...-c4ef217 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Nov 10, 2017 License: GPL-3.0 Imports: 4 Imported by: 1

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type ArrayOfCISkillsetReadType

type ArrayOfCISkillsetReadType struct {
	XMLName xml.Name `xml:"http://datatypes.ci.ccmm.applications.nortel.com ArrayOfCISkillsetReadType"`

	CISkillsetReadType []*CISkillsetReadType `xml:"CISkillsetReadType,omitempty"`
}

ArrayOfCISkillsetReadType -

type CIMultipleSkillsetsReadType

type CIMultipleSkillsetsReadType struct {
	XMLName xml.Name `xml:"http://datatypes.ci.ccmm.applications.nortel.com CIMultipleSkillsetsReadType"`

	SkillsetList *ArrayOfCISkillsetReadType `xml:"skillsetList,omitempty"`
}

CIMultipleSkillsetsReadType -

type CISkillsetReadType

type CISkillsetReadType struct {
	ID int64 `xml:"id,omitempty"`

	Name string `xml:"name,omitempty"`

	Tag string `xml:"tag,omitempty"`
}

CISkillsetReadType -

type GetAllEmailSkillsets

type GetAllEmailSkillsets stru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llEmailSkillsets"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etAllEmailSkillsets -

type GetAllEmailSkillsetsResponse

type GetAllEmailSkillsetsRes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llEmailSkillsetsResponse"`

	GetAllEmailSkillsetsResult *CIMultipleSkillsetsReadType `xml:"GetAllEmailSkillsetsResult,omitempty"`
}

GetAllEmailSkillsetsResponse -

type GetAllOutboundSkillsets

type GetAllOutboundSkillsets stru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llOutboundSkillsets"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etAllOutboundSkillsets -

type GetAllOutboundSkillsetsResponse

type GetAllOutboundSkillsetsRes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llOutboundSkillsetsResponse"`

	GetAllOutboundSkillsetsResult *CIMultipleSkillsetsReadType `xml:"GetAllOutboundSkillsetsResult,omitempty"`
}

GetAllOutboundSkillsetsResponse -

type GetAllSkillsets

type GetAllSkillsets stru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llSkillsets"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etAllSkillsets -

type GetAllSkillsetsResponse

type GetAllSkillsetsRes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llSkillsetsResponse"`

	GetAllSkillsetsResult *CIMultipleSkillsetsReadType `xml:"GetAllSkillsetsResult,omitempty"`
}

GetAllSkillsetsResponse -

type GetAllWebSkillsets

type GetAllWebSkillsets stru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llWebSkillsets"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etAllWebSkillsets -

type GetAllWebSkillsetsResponse

type GetAllWebSkillsetsRes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etAllWebSkillsetsResponse"`

	GetAllWebSkillsetsResult *CIMultipleSkillsetsReadType `xml:"GetAllWebSkillsetsResult,omitempty"`
}

GetAllWebSkillsetsResponse -

type GetSkillsetByID

type GetSkillsetByID stru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etSkillsetByID"`

	ID int64 `xml:"id,omitempty"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etSkillsetByID -

type GetSkillsetByIDResponse

type GetSkillsetByIDRes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etSkillsetByIDResponse"`

	GetSkillsetByIDResult *CISkillsetReadType `xml:"GetSkillsetByIDResult,omitempty"`
}

GetSkillsetByIDResponse -

type GetSkillsetByName

type GetSkillsetByName stru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etSkillsetByName"`

	SkillsetName string `xml:"skillsetName,omitempty"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

GetSkillsetByName -

type GetSkillsetByNameResponse

type GetSkillsetByNameRes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com GetSkillsetByNameResponse"`

	GetSkillsetByNameResult *CISkillsetReadType `xml:"GetSkillsetByNameResult,omitempty"`
}

GetSkillsetByNameResponse -

type IsSkillsetInService

type IsSkillsetInService stru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com IsSkillsetInService"`

	SkillsetID int64 `xml:"skillsetID,omitempty"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

IsSkillsetInService -

type IsSkillsetInServiceResponse

type IsSkillsetInServiceRes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com IsSkillsetInServiceResponse"`

	IsSkillsetInServiceResult bool `xml:"IsSkillsetInServiceResult,omitempty"`
}

IsSkillsetInServiceResponse -

type IsSkillsetNameInService

type IsSkillsetNameInService stru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com IsSkillsetNameInService"`

	SkillsetName string `xml:"skillsetName,omitempty"`
}

IsSkillsetNameInService -

type IsSkillsetNameInServiceResponse

type IsSkillsetNameInServiceRes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com IsSkillsetNameInServiceResponse"`

	IsSkillsetNameInServiceResult bool `xml:"IsSkillsetNameInServiceResult,omitempty"`
}

IsSkillsetNameInServiceResponse -

type ReadSkillsetByName

type ReadSkillsetByName stru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com ReadSkillsetByName"`

	SkillsetName string `xml:"skillsetName,omitempty"`

	SessionKey string `xml:"sessionKey,omitempty"`
}

ReadSkillsetByName -

type ReadSkillsetByNameResponse

type ReadSkillsetByNameResponse struct {
	XMLName xml.Name `xml:"http://webservices.ci.ccmm.applications.nortel.com ReadSkillsetByNameResponse"`

	ReadSkillsetByNameResult *CISkillsetReadType `xml:"ReadSkillsetByNameResult,omitempty"`
}

ReadSkillsetByNameResponse -

type Soap

type Soap struct {
	// contains filtered or unexported fields
}

Soap -

func NewSoap

func NewSoap(baseURL string, tls bool, auth *soap.BasicAuth, verbose bool) *Soap

NewSoap -

func (*Soap) GetAllEmailSkillsets

func (service *Soap) GetAllEmailSkillsets(ctx context.Context, request *GetAllEmailSkillsets) (*GetAllEmailSkillsetsResponse, error)

GetAllEmailSkillsets -

func (*Soap) GetAllOutboundSkillsets

func (service *Soap) GetAllOutboundSkillsets(ctx context.Context, request *GetAllOutboundSkillsets) (*GetAllOutboundSkillsetsResponse, error)

GetAllOutboundSkillsets -

func (*Soap) GetAllSkillsets

func (service *Soap) GetAllSkillsets(ctx context.Context, request *GetAllSkillsets) (*GetAllSkillsetsResponse, error)

GetAllSkillsets -

func (*Soap) GetAllWebSkillsets

func (service *Soap) GetAllWebSkillsets(ctx context.Context, request *GetAllWebSkillsets) (*GetAllWebSkillsetsResponse, error)

GetAllWebSkillsets -

func (*Soap) GetSkillsetByID

func (service *Soap) GetSkillsetByID(ctx context.Context, request *GetSkillsetByID) (*GetSkillsetByIDResponse, error)

GetSkillsetByID -

func (*Soap) GetSkillsetByName

func (service *Soap) GetSkillsetByName(ctx context.Context, request *GetSkillsetByName) (*GetSkillsetByNameResponse, error)

GetSkillsetByName -

func (*Soap) IsSkillsetInService

func (service *Soap) IsSkillsetInService(ctx context.Context, request *IsSkillsetInService) (*IsSkillsetInServiceResponse, error)

IsSkillsetInService -

func (*Soap) IsSkillsetNameInService

func (service *Soap) IsSkillsetNameInService(ctx context.Context, request *IsSkillsetNameInService) (*IsSkillsetNameInServiceResponse, error)

IsSkillsetNameInService -

func (*Soap) ReadSkillsetByName

func (service *Soap) ReadSkillsetByName(ctx context.Context, request *ReadSkillsetByName) (*ReadSkillsetByNameResponse, error)

ReadSkillsetByName -

func (*Soap) SetHeader

func (service *Soap) SetHeader(header interface{})

SetHeader -

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L